More about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ology

If you're considering a career in the automotive industry, the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ology is an excellent starting point. This qualification not only equips you with essential skills needed for roles such as Apprentice Mechanic and Tyre Fitter, but also opens doors to other career paths like Automotive Mechanic and Warehouse Assistant. Delivered by the local provider MTA WA (through Online delivery), students in Gisborne can conveniently access quality education right in their area.

By undertaking this course, you'll gain valuable knowledge and experience applicable to various fields, including Transport and Logistics, Manufacturing, and Trades. With the automotive sector continually growing, obtaining a Certificate II in Automotive Tyre Servicing Technology can significantly enhance your employability. You'll not only be prepared for jobs such as Automotive Workshop Assistant and Vehicle Service Assistant, but also for specialised roles like Fleet Service Assistant.
